Ever wanted to change how the numbers appear in Archicad, but could not find the settings in the Dimension Preferences? By default all numbers are showing commas for digit grouping and full stops for decimals.

This can be very easily changed in the system settings of your OS as Archicad uses the global settings.
On Windows
Open the Control Panel/Region and Language.

Click Additional settings… in the bottom right.

Set Decimal symbol and Digit grouping symbol respectively and click Apply.

On Mac
Open System Preferences/Language & Region and click Advanced…

Set the Number separators and click OK.

Using both systems, the settings will only be activated after you restart Archicad.
